Arenal Volcano

Tourist attractions Arenal Volcano

Located in the heart of Costa Rica, Arenal Volcano is one of the country’s most iconic and active volcanoes. Situated near the town of La Fortuna, this majestic volcano rises over 1,600 meters above sea level and offers visitors a breathtaking view of its perfectly symmetrical cone. The surrounding area is equally stunning, with hot springs like Tabacón, lush rainforests, and pristine lakes, providing the perfect backdrop for outdoor adventures such as hiking, zip-lining, and wildlife watching. Arenal is also renowned for its nearby Arenal Lake, the largest in Costa Rica, offering opportunities for water activities like kayaking and fishing.

A fascinating fact about Arenal Volcano is that it remained in a constant state of eruption for nearly 43 years, from 1968 until 2010, making it one of the most active volcanoes in the world during that time. While the eruptions have subsided, the volcano’s beauty and the surrounding nature continue to attract travelers seeking a mix of adventure, relaxation, and natural wonder. Whether you’re enjoying a peaceful soak in the hot springs or exploring the nearby trails, Arenal remains a must-visit destination in Costa Rica.
